VEHICLE ACCIDENT: Fresno Crash Leaves Woman Seriously Injured

January 20, 2010

Fresno – A woman was seriously injured after her vehicle crashed onto a big rig in Highway 99 before hitting a guardrail, the California Highway Patrol said.

Thirty- one year-old Gina Freeeman of Selma was travelling on her southbound Chrysler that was exceeding 65mph in the fastlane of Orange Avenue when she failed to negotiate an oncoming road condition and lost control of the vehicle.

Freeman reportedly drove into a gravel median when the lane she was driving on ended, as four lanes were reduced to three. She then veered onto the path of a Freightliner before hitting a guardrail.

Freeman was taken to Community Regional Medical Center where her condition remained critical.
